Step-by-step explanation:
The altitude of the triangle can be found using the triangle area formula:
A = 1/2bh
22.7 km² = 1/2(10.8 km)h
h = (22.7 km²)/(5.4 km) ≈ 4.2037... km
The missing measurement is about 4.2 km.
